Margaret Ransone

Margaret Ransone served in the House of Delegates from 2012 to 2024 (HD99).
Republican

Personal Gifts/Entertainment


Date Lobbying Client Description
2/16/2017 National Rifle Association Dinner (Details)

METHODOLOGY: Lobbyists disclosed providing Margaret Ransone with the listed entertainment, travel or gifts.